Coin Detail
Click here to see enlarged image.
ID:     RICK016B
Type:     Roman Imperial
Issuer:     Martinian
Date Ruled:     AD 324
Metal:     Bronze
Denomination:     AE 3
Struck / Cast:     struck
Date Struck:     AD 324
Weight:     1.99 g
Obverse Legend:     IM CS MAR MARTINIANVĪ“ P F AVS
Obverse Description:     Radiate, draped and cuirassed bust right
Reverse Legend:     IOVI CONS_ERVATORI
Reverse Description:     Jupiter standing left with chlamys across left shoulder, Victory on globe in right hand, left hand leaning on eagle-tipped scepter; eagle with wreath in beak to left on ground; to right captive seated on ground.
Exergue:     SMKB
Mint Mark:     SMKB/ X/II episemon in right field
Mint:     Cyzicus
Primary Reference:     RIC VII 016 var
Reference2:     SRCV 3824v (obverse inscription)
Reference3:     VM 001v (obverse inscription)
Reference4:     Vagi 3037
Photograph Credit:     Gemini Numismatic Auctions, LLC
Source:     http://www.geminiauction.com
Price Sold For:     5000 USD
Date Sold:     08.01.2008
Grade:     VF
Notes:     (1) Officina "B" is unrecorded for this issue (2) Gemini, LLC Auction IV; Lot No. 509 (3) Note the blundered obverse legend, which in fact may be the norm. This "alteration" was not noted in RIC despite the obvious example on Plate 22.
